The Essential Role of Accessories in Mobile Gaming

Accessories have become integral to enhancing the mobile gaming experience, whether you’re a casual player or an aspiring esports champion. High-quality peripherals can provide better control, immersion, and comfort, allowing you to fully enjoy your gaming sessions. For instance, mobile controllers and a pro controller significantly improve precision and control, enabling players to perform at their best.
Serious gamers now invest in quality peripherals to gain a competitive edge. For example, the Razer BlackWidow V4 keyboard is a premium accessory that caters to mobile gamers using Bluetooth or cloud gaming platforms. This keyboard offers exceptional tactile feedback and durability, making it a top choice for competitive players.
Audio accessories like gaming earphones and specialized headphones have become popular among mobile gamers. These accessories enhance the auditory experience, allowing players to hear game details and communicate effectively with teammates. Around 40% of mobile gamers opt for headphones with features like noise cancellation.
Portable power banks are another essential accessory for mobile gamers. These devices ensure that your mobile device remains charged during extended gaming sessions, preventing interruptions and allowing you to focus on your performance. Cooling fans are also frequently used by gamers playing resource-heavy games to prevent device overheating and maintain performance.
A tablet stand or phone mount enhances comfort and focus during long gaming sessions, offering hands-free gameplay. Gaming gloves can also improve grip and touch accuracy, helping players maintain control during fast-paced mobile gaming. How to Choose the Right Accessories Based on Game Type
Choosing the right essential accessories can make a significant difference in your gaming experience, especially when considering the type of games you play. Different genres require different tools for optimal performance and enjoyment.
For FPS games, accessories like triggers, controllers with precision aim pads, and headsets with excellent sound quality are essential. These tools provide better control, accuracy, and haptic feedback, allowing you to react quickly and accurately in fast-paced environments. Hall effect triggers enhance the overall gaming experience.
MOBA and strategy games, on the other hand, benefit from responsive keyboards and headsets. A high-quality keyboard can improve your ability to execute complex commands quickly, while a good headset ensures clear communication with your team.
Racing games require mounts and responsive joysticks for a more immersive experience. A sturdy mount keeps your device stable, while a responsive joystick provides precise control over your vehicle, making the game more enjoyable and realistic.

Key Features to Look For When Buying Mobile Gaming Gear

When buying mobile gaming gear, several key features should be considered to ensure you get the best mobile performance and value for your investment.
Low latency wireless mode performance is essential for competitive gaming, as it ensures that your inputs are registered quickly and accurately. Look for accessories that offer a low latency connection to avoid lag and improve your responsiveness.
Battery life and charging speed are also crucial factors to consider. Long solid battery life ensures that your accessories can last through extended gaming sessions, while fast charging speeds mean you can get back to gaming quickly after a recharge using a rechargeable battery and usb c port.
Ergonomics and durability are important for comfort and longevity. Accessories with ergonomic controllers reduce strain and fatigue during long gaming sessions, while high quality materials ensure that your gear can withstand regular use.
Compatibility with multiple platforms, such as iOS devices, Android, and cloud gaming services, is another key feature to look for. This ensures that all your devices can be used with various accessories, providing versatility and convenience.
Extra features like programmable buttons, customizable RGB lighting, and sound quality enhancements can also enhance your gaming experience. These features allow you to personalize your gear and create a setup that meets your specific needs and preferences.
